-
제네릭Swift/swift 문법 2023. 3. 27. 21:37
when
함수가 여러 타입으로 정의될 필요가 있는 경우 사용
한번의 구현으로 모든 타입을 커버 가능
선언 방법
: <T>이용
func swap<T>(a: inout T,b: inout T) { let temA = a a = b b = temA }
'Swift > swift 문법' 카테고리의 다른 글
프로토콜 - Equatable, Comparable (0) 2023.04.03 확장에서의 생성자 사용 (0) 2023.03.29 에러 처리 (0) 2023.03.27 Result Type (0) 2023.03.27 스위프트 : addSubView 위에 버튼 추가 (0) 2022.10.05